Back in April 2020 I reported my 419 had a strange oscillation of 2vpp at 9hz occurring at at 3-- cardinal ranges (e.g. 3mv,30mv...30v,300v). Having no success in troubleshooting, ( I had spent days checking resistors and connections on switch S1) even with the kind help of experts, I put that meter aside, and paid attention to a second 419 I have. I re-lamped, and built a new battery pack for the second meter. The second meter doesn't have the strange oscillation. I swapped A4 boards to verify the oscillation remained with the first meter. The oscillations must be due to some defect in one or more photocells in meter one, or in one or more of the components surrounding the chopper block. Ripping out, and replacing the diodes and caps on the chopper block would have been a PITA with no guarantee of success, if it turns out to be a photocell. Getting the second meter working was preferable. I know that I have seen this oscillation complaint on other forums, as well. So, hopefully, this report should be useful for those with an oscillating 419.
